RTFM... you don`t have a DTS mobo, in the specs list you provided DTS isn`t listed, only SS3 (Sonic Studio III) so your driver is "UAD - ASUS ROG SS3 MB" ...first follow step by step the cleanup process by the letter and after that install the SS3 only driver (UAD - ASUS ROG SS3 MB - the first one in the list)
